Job Description

Overview:
The Warehouse Worker role deals directly with receiving, storing and distributing material, tools, equipment and products for all departments at Snapping Shoals EMC. A successful candidate prioritizes safety, enjoys physical work, is detail oriented, and desires to efficiently meet the requests of others in a team environment.
Responsibilities:
Key Responsibilities:
Reads/fills work orders, shipping documents, or requisitions to determine items to be moved, gathered, or distributed to their proper areas. Sorts, marks, and places materials or items on racks, shelves, or in bins according to predetermined sequence such as size, type, style, color, or product code. Opens bales, crates, and other containers. Drives vehicle to transport stored items from warehouse to job sites when necessary. Maintains up to date material inventory records and assists with semiannual inventories. Operates forklift. Maintains proper emergency material levels for emergency purposes only. Checks stock for material needs, makes list of items and quantity to reorder for Warehouse Supervisor - maintains vendor rotation to keep orders current. Keeps all wire tagged as to size and type and quantity on hand, figures remaining quantity of wire using footage markings on cable. Maintains adequate security of warehouse area. Keeps inside of warehouse clean and orderly. Issues PPE and makes sure all have been tested or are within given expiration periods. Maintains daily records on all wire and materials stored outside given to employees, contractors, or other customers from storage warehouse for inventory control. Scans and issues meters and reconnect collars. Completes daily import process and reporting for collars and meters. Other duties as assigned.
